The Malta International Fireworks Festival kicks off in Valletta today, promising four evenings of dazzling spectacle.
Unlike previous editions, the event is this year taking place mainly in Grand Harbour, except for one night in Nadur, Gozo. All shows start at 8pm.
The festival will feature traditional displays, non-competitive pyro shows, a pyro show competition and entertainment by various bands.
Fireworks factories from all over Malta and Gozo are taking part, while the competition will also see the participation of a number of foreign companies.
The best area to enjoy the magic in the sky and listen to the music and entertainment on stage is at Valletta Waterfront (Quarry Wharf Road). Limited seating will also be available there but seats need to be booked in advance here.

The festival will continue in Valletta on Friday, April 25, in Nadur on Saturday, April 26 and will culminate with a grand finale again in Valletta on Wednesday, April 30.
